In Alfred Schnittke’s intriguing compositions, various styles clash with each other, and the artist often seasoned musical quotes with a dose of dark humour. This is also the case of the work being the axis of the NFM Leopoldinum Orchestra concert. The programme is complemented by classical works by Joseph Haydn and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, with whom Schnittke dialogued in his composition.
Moz-Art à la Haydn by Alfred Schnittke dates from 1977 and is scored for two violins and a small string orchestra. In this work, Schnittke freely uses quotations from various works by Haydn and Mozart. The former is represented by fragments of the Symphony in F sharp minor “Farewell”, the latter by a quote from the Symphony in G minor KV 550 and sketches from an unfinished humorous pantomime. Haydn’s and Mozart’s idioms were processed by Schnittke with a use of modern articulation and harmonic means that give an impression of listening to Viennese Classicists as if reflected in a distorting mirror. Equally important are the elements of staging in this work. The performance of Moz-Art à la Haydn begins with the lights off, and toward the end of the work, the individual musicians leave the stage, and at the very end only the conductor keeps track of time.
The second part of the evening will begin with the performance of Mozart’s Divertimento in D major KV 251. This six-movement composition was written in July 1776 in Salzburg to celebrate his sister’s name day or birthday (the former was celebrated on June 26 and the latter on June 30), hence it is sometimes called “Nannerl septet”. It is music full of grace and elegance, in which the melody comes to the fore. The Divertimento was a very popular genre in the music of the 18th century, and thanks to its lightness and accessibility, it was hugely popular and treated as light entertainment. Haydn’s Symphony in C minor Hob I:52 will be the last work in the programme, one of his last pieces from the period of “Sturm und Drang”. The compositions written by Haydn at that time are full of dramatic tension. For this reason, one scholar has referred to the Symphony in C minor as “the grandfather of Beethoven’s Fifth Symphony”. Both works are connected not only by the precision of form, but also by a huge load of expression and the presence of numerous contrasts. These elements continue to surprise and engage modern listeners.
